TensorFlow CI Tools 是一套用于简化 TensorFlow 项目持续集成和持续部署(CI/CD)流程的工具。它可以帮助开发者自动化测试、构建和部署 TensorFlow 项目。

特性

  • 自动化测试:集成多种测试框架,如 JUnit、pytest 等,确保代码质量。
  • 持续构建:支持多种构建系统,如 Maven、Gradle 等,自动构建项目。
  • 持续部署:支持自动化部署到各种环境,如本地、测试、生产等。

使用方法

  1. 安装 TensorFlow CI Tools

    pip install tensorflow-ci-tools
    
  2. 配置 CI/CD 流程 在项目的根目录下创建 .tfci.yml 文件,配置构建和部署流程。

  3. 运行 CI/CD 任务

    tfci run
    

扩展阅读

想要了解更多关于 TensorFlow CI Tools 的信息,可以访问我们的官方文档

TensorFlow Logo